2024-11-21Auto merge of #132362 - mustartt:aix-dylib-detection, r=jieyouxubors-22/+127
[AIX] change system dynamic library format Historically on AIX, almost all dynamic libraries are distributed in `.a` Big Archive Format which can consists of both static and shared objects in the same archive (e.g. `libc++abi.a(libc++abi.so.1)`). During the initial porting process, the dynamic libraries are kept as `.a` to simplify the migration, but semantically having an XCOFF object under the archive extension is wrong. For crate type `cdylib` we want to be able to distribute the libraries as archives as well. We are migrating to archives with the following format: ``` $ ar -t lib<name>.a lib<name>.so ``` where each archive contains a single member that is a shared XCOFF object that can be loaded.

2024-11-21Rollup merge of #131736 - hoodmane:emscripten-wasm-bigint, r=workingjubileeMatthias Krüger-4/+5
Emscripten: link with -sWASM_BIGINT When linking an executable without dynamic linking, this is a pure improvement. It significantly reduces code size and avoids a lot of buggy behaviors. It is supported in all browsers for many years and in all maintained versions of Node. It does change the ABI, so people who are dynamically linking with a library or executable that uses the old ABI may need to turn it off. It can be disabled if needed by passing `-Clink-arg -sWASM_BIGINT=0` to `rustc`. But few people will want to turn it off. Note this includes a libc bump to 0.2.162!

2024-11-21Rewrite `show_md_content_with_pager`.Nicholas Nethercote-49/+43
I think the control flow in this function is complicated and confusing, largely due to the use of two booleans `print_formatted` and `fallback_to_println` that are set in multiple places and then used to guide proceedings. As well as hurting readability, this leads to at least one bug: if the `write_termcolor_buf` call fails and the pager also fails, the function will try to print color output to stdout, but that output will be empty because `write_termcolor_buf` failed. I.e. the `if fallback_to_println` body fails to check `print_formatted`. This commit rewrites the function to be neater and more Rust-y, e.g. by putting the result of `write_termcolor_buf` into an `Option` so it can only be used on success, and by using `?` more. It also changes terminology a little, using "pretty" to mean "formatted and colorized". The result is a little shorter, more readable, and less buggy.

2024-11-21Add metavariables to `TokenDescription`.Nicholas Nethercote-17/+59
Pasted metavariables are wrapped in invisible delimiters, which pretty-print as empty strings, and changing that can break some proc macros. But error messages saying "expected identifer, found ``" are bad. So this commit adds support for metavariables in `TokenDescription` so they print as "metavariable" in error messages, instead of "``". It's not used meaningfully yet, but will be needed to get rid of interpolated tokens.

2024-11-20Rollup merge of #133226 - compiler-errors:opt-in-pointer-like, r=lcnrMatthias Krüger-156/+195
Make `PointerLike` opt-in instead of built-in The `PointerLike` trait currently is a built-in trait that computes the layout of the type. This is a bit problematic, because types implement this trait automatically. Since this can be broken due to semver-compatible changes to a type's layout, this is undesirable. Also, calling `layout_of` in the trait system also causes cycles. This PR makes the trait implemented via regular impls, and adds additional validation on top to make sure that those impls are valid. This could eventually be `derive()`d for custom smart pointers, and we can trust *that* as a semver promise rather than risking library authors accidentally breaking it. On the other hand, we may never expose `PointerLike`, but at least now the implementation doesn't invoke `layout_of` which could cause ICEs or cause cycles. Right now for a `PointerLike` impl to be valid, it must be an ADT that is `repr(transparent)` and the non-1zst field needs to implement `PointerLike`. There are also some primitive impls for `&T`/ `&mut T`/`*const T`/`*mut T`/`Box<T>`.
2024-11-20Rollup merge of #132708 - estebank:const-as-binding, r=NadrierilMatthias Krüger-94/+365
Point at `const` definition when used instead of a binding in a `let` statement Modify `PatKind::InlineConstant` to be `ExpandedConstant` standing in not only for inline `const` blocks but also for `const` items. This allows us to track named `const`s used in patterns when the pattern is a single binding. When we detect that there is a refutable pattern involving a `const` that could have been a binding instead, we point at the `const` item, and suggest renaming. We do this for both `let` bindings and `match` expressions missing a catch-all arm if there's at least one single binding pattern referenced.
